Workplace injuries may take weeks or months to fully heal

It could take weeks or even months, depending on the severity of your injury to fully recover. During this period, it is crucial to communicate with your employer to ensure your return to work in a safe manner. Sometimes, it's better to take on a lighter-duty job to help you recover faster.

There are a lot of employers that offer programs for stay-at-work. This lets injured workers earn a portion of their salary while continuing to provide for their families. If your employer does not have a plan in place, you can work together to find a job that is suitable for your needs.

To file a claim you can also use the workers' compensation system. It will pay for your medical expenses and any financial expenses resulting from your injury. It's not a replacement for your income. An attorney for workers' compensation is a good idea in case you're facing financial difficulties. They can help you file for benefits and ensure that you follow the doctor's advice.

While recovering, you may be asked by your doctor workers compensation lawsuit to perform light-duty work. These tasks could include standing, bending, pushing or climbing. You can use the form of an activity prescription to document your restrictions.

Temporary or permanent work restrictions could be granted. These restrictions can prevent you from engaging in risky activities like heavy lifting. These restrictions will gradually be lifted as your recovery progresses.

Your doctor might suggest to take regular rest breaks. It is also possible to be suggested a modified job, or even a change to your workplace. You may also be advised to get a medical evaluation from an independent source to determine if you're able to safely resume your previous job.

It is important to remember that taking too much time off from work may not only prolong your recovery time but could also make it difficult for you to perform your job. Making sure that your doctor and employer are informed of your situation will help you receive the proper care and get the right benefits.
